Open letter to Allen Alley, Solomon Yue, and Terri Moffett of the ORP.

I am appalled, disgusted, and ashamed to consider myself a Republican after the shenanigans displayed Saturrday at the 4thCongressional District’s Convention held in Roseburg. Not only were we, the duly elected representatives of our precincts, lied to, we were stolen from as well!

Towards the end of the allotted time for our convention (scheduled to adjourn at 5PM), we were given a choice to speed the votes along,  or wait and finish up according to the rules of the ORP. After a passionate  speech by Jeffrey Osanka, explaining that the rules are in place for a reason, we voted to remain at UCC until our business was appropriately concluded.  


We continued voting for District Officers and were told we were waiting for the rest of the State’s votes to be counted in order to move forward to the 3rd ballot for at-large alternate delegates to the RNC in Tampa.


After the ballots were collected, we waited a little while for the results of the district officers. At approximately 5:30PM, we were told that all the other Districts in the State of Oregon had shut down and there was no further business we could conduct. A motion to adjourn was introduced.  


Most of us in attendance were stunned! How could we possibly adjourn when we still had 2 more rounds of voting to complete? After much outcry from the crowd, a motion was introduced for District 4 to continue voting irrespective of the rest of the State. The motion passed. Then we were informed that our votes may not even be counted since the other Districts had shut down. We did not care. We came to make our voices heard and decided to continue to vote on.

Next, we find out that the ballots are gone! OK, fine. We are at a college. We can find blank paper and hand write the names of our chosen delegates. Come to find out not just the blank ballots are gone, but the completed ballots with all of our previous votes have been taken by Terri Moffett of the ORP.  

I was in shock! How dare she take our ballots when we  are still in session? Who gave her the right to remove those votes? I stood up and asked Fred Dayton, Jr. Vice-Chair of CD4, “Under whose authority did she take our ballots?” Fred answered that she is the liaison to CD4 from the ORP and that her boss told her to take the ballots. I then asked Fred a follow-up question, “Who is her boss?” His answer was, “Allen Alley.” I thanked Fred and sat down.

Then the anger really began. Again, the room erupted in outrage! How dare Mr. Alley instruct Ms. Moffett, his employee, to remove our ballots when we were not done voting? Who gave him the right to attempt to silence the PCPs of CD4?

Wait, it gets better…

 Previously we were told that all the other Districts had shut down around 5PM. This was not the case. Thanks to the modern technologies of smart phones, wireless internet, and Facebook, we found out that CD2 had not shut down. They were still voting.

Moments later, our ballots were back. Hmm…

Even though we did not have the results from the rest of the Districts, we voted our 3rd ballot… and waited, and waited, and waited… We found out that CD5 had resumed their convention. Another hmm… We waited until after 7:30PM for the tellers to count our votes.

Finally, the votes were counted and we moved on to selecting our 4th District Alternates. The votes were counted and results announced after 8:30PM.

I am wondering why a convention that was supposed to take 8 hours was stalled and made to run over 3 hours longer than anticipated. I am wondering why we were lied to about the other Districts shutting down in order to attempt to prevent us from voting. I am wondering why our ballots were taken away (cast and blank) before we were adjourned. I am wondering why you attempted to steal our voices by taking away our opportunity to vote for the delegates of our choice.

Furthermore, I am wondering if the votes we cast before 5PM are going to count. We rightfully and according to the rules of the ORP selected at-large delegates and district delegates, along with presidential electors before we were told the other Districts had shut down. What happens now to those people who we selected to go to Tampa?

Two numbers for PERS members to keep in mind
http://www.statesmanjournal.com/article/20120625/COLUMN0105/306250020/1064?nclick_check=1
Oregon PERS members, there are two numbers you should keep in mind during the next couple of years: 6 percent and 8 percent.

 These percentages are going to be key to some major arguments that will crop up over Oregon’s public pension system.


The 6 percent refers, of course, to the employee contribution to PERS required under Oregon law. It also refers to the practice known as the “pick-up,” in which the public employer can agree to pay that contribution on behalf of its workers, usually in lieu of a raise.

The 8 percent refers to the assumed rate of return that PERS uses in its budgeting. In other words, PERS expects to earn an average 8 percent on its multi-billion-dollar pension fund, over time.

RMPs for Western  Oregon
The  BLM Oregon is initiating a resource management plan (RMP) revisions which will provide goals, objectives, and direction for the management of approximately 2.6  million acres of BLM-administered lands in western  Oregon.  
 
Having attended the Eugene BLM meeting, it is clear that the intent is NOT Forest Management for Timber Harvest, but for the  Protection of the Spotted Owl and Forest Management for Climate  change. I remember when they used to manage and prepare for next years weather,  not if it is going to be warmer or cooler in 100 years. 'useful  idiots'.
 
I ask the question, where are the Foresters?
 
The O&C Act of 1937 set aside approximately 2.4 million acres of federally-owned  forest lands in 18 western Oregon counties for the economic benefit of those  counties. 
According to USFS records the volume of timber harvested, measured in thousands of board feet (mbf) on USFS 
lands has declined from a peak harvest in 1973 of 5,791,353 mbf to 1,126,867 mbf in 1994 to 419,381 mbf in 2007.

Signed into law in 1973, the goal of the Endangered Species Act (ESA) was to preserve, protect and recover key domestic species. However, today the law is failing to achieve its primary purpose of species recovery and instead has become a tool  for litigation that drains resources away from real recovery efforts and blocks job-creating economic activities.


It has been 23 years since Congress has reauthorized or made any significant, responsible improvements to the Endangered Species Act to ensure that it works for both species and people. After more than two decades, the ESA should be modernized and updated to once again focus the law on true species recovery.

Get the Facts:
In the United States, 1,383 species are listed under the ESA: 5828 animals and 795 plants.

 Of the domestic species protected by the ESA, the Fish and Wildlife Service has declared only 20 species recovered. This represents a 1 percent recovery  rate.

 According to the Government Accountability Office (GAO), the average cost for the recovery of an endangered species is $15.9 million. The average cost of a complete listing decision is $85,000.

 The U. S. Fish and Wildlife Service has designated 97.8 million acres and 40,000 miles of coastal rivers and streams as “critical habitat” for 603 listed species. The cost of a single designation of critical habitat is $515,000.


In the past ten years, Congress has appropriated $1.4 billion to the U. S. Fish and Wildlife Service to conduct ESA activities including listing, consultation and recovery efforts and $174.3 million to the National Marine Fisheries
  Service to undertake ESA related activities.


In July 2011 the Interior Department agreed to a settlement that covered 779 species in 85 lawsuits and legal actions. Information obtained from agencies indicates that they have a combined total of over 180 pending ESA-related
  lawsuits.


According to the Washington Post, “In fiscal 2010, the Fish and Wildlife Service spent so much of its $21 million listing budget on litigation and responding to petitions that it had almost no money to devote to placing new species under federal protection, according to agency officials.”

They just keep spending.


Apparently unfazed by the spending-driven crisis in Europe and our $16 trillion debt here at home, the U.S. Senate is actually considering whether to spend a trillion dollars over the next ten years on the so-called Farm Bill. 

In 2008, the country spent $51 billion on these programs and by 2011 it had almost doubled to $98 billion. Somehow the bill’s lead sponsor (Senator Stabenow from Michigan) has the audacity to claim $23 billion in deficit
reduction over ten years. As AFP Policy Analyst Christine Harbin wrote, “Lawmakers are now patting themselves on the back for locking in those huge increases and then cutting a little bit around the edges.”


Take Action Today and Urge your Senator to Vote NO on this Bloated Spending Bill! 

What’s worse, this whole package is masquerading through Congress under the guise of being a Farm Bill. But in 2011 almost 80% of the funding went to food stamps and other supplemental nutrition programs. With less than a quarter of the spending in this bill actually going to farm programs, perhaps it would be more appropriate to call this the Food Stamps Bill. 

The bill also claims to end direct payments to crop producers but it puts in a whole new program called “shallow
loss
” where Congress guarantees big agribusinesses’  revenues will never fall below 90% of their average revenues over the last five years. If a crop has a bad year or if prices fall, Uncle Sam is there to make up the difference. It’s a guaranteed minimum income and it’s just as bad as direct  payments.
